Transaction 3e704311ccc94fabba7c5c5026229e19eb683b64c543a9c9a9e7a66638b8be09

1 Input
2 Outputs
  • 3e704311ccc94fabba7c5c5026229e19eb683b64c543a9c9a9e7a66638b8be09:0
  • value  9578
    address  bc1qj65dyxamcm36e5q7q7nm2a5xlu72gu76lzxhuv
  • 3e704311ccc94fabba7c5c5026229e19eb683b64c543a9c9a9e7a66638b8be09:1
  • value  259496
    address  33vrusSyiqZcMKYkNxiK8ofjCuTkpUPzxr